The Tata Nexon (facelift 2023) 1.2 Revotron is a subcompact SUV produced by the Indian manufacturer Tata Motors. Introduced in September 2023, this iteration represents a significant refresh of the Nexon model, which initially launched in 2017. While Tata Motors is primarily known in India, the Nexon is a key model in their strategy to expand into international markets, particularly within developing economies. The 2023 facelift focuses on enhanced styling, improved interior features, and updated safety technology, aiming to compete with other popular subcompact SUVs like the Maruti Suzuki Brezza and Hyundai Venue in the Indian market. This version, equipped with the 1.2-liter Revotron engine and a 6-speed manual transmission, is designed to offer a balance of fuel efficiency and performance for urban driving conditions.

Engine & Performance
The heart of the Tata Nexon (facelift 2023) 1.2 Revotron is a 1.2-liter, inline-three cylinder turbocharged gasoline engine. This engine produces 120 horsepower at 5500 rpm and 170 Nm (125.39 lb.-ft.) of torque between 1750 and 4000 rpm. The power-to-litre ratio is a respectable 100.1 hp/l. The engine utilizes multi-port fuel injection and an intercooler to optimize combustion and enhance performance. Coupled with a 6-speed manual transmission, the Nexon offers a relatively engaging driving experience, particularly in urban environments. The front-wheel-drive configuration contributes to fuel efficiency, and the inclusion of a Start & Stop system further aids in reducing fuel consumption. While not a performance-oriented vehicle, the 1.2 Revotron engine provides adequate power for everyday driving needs and highway cruising.
Design & Features
The Tata Nexon (facelift 2023) boasts a modern and stylish exterior design. As a subcompact SUV, it features a five-door layout with seating for five passengers. The vehicle’s dimensions are 3995 mm (157.28 in.) in length, 1804 mm (71.02 in.) in width, and 1620 mm (63.78 in.) in height, with a wheelbase of 2498 mm (98.35 in.). A notable feature is its 208 mm (8.19 in.) of ground clearance, making it well-suited for navigating challenging road conditions commonly found in India. The interior of the facelifted Nexon has been significantly upgraded, with a focus on improved materials and a more contemporary dashboard layout. Key features include a touchscreen infotainment system, digital instrument cluster, and enhanced safety features such as ABS (Anti-lock Braking System). The trunk offers a minimum capacity of 382 liters (13.49 cu. ft.), providing ample space for luggage and cargo. The vehicle’s design language incorporates Tata’s Impact 2.0 design philosophy, characterized by bold lines and a distinctive front grille.
Technical Specifications
| Brand | Tata |
| Model | Nexon |
| Generation | Nexon (facelift 2023) |
| Type (Engine) | 1.2 Revotron (120 Hp) Manual 6-speed |
| Start of production | September, 2023 |
| Powertrain Architecture | Internal Combustion engine |
| Body type | SUV |
| Seats | 5 |
| Doors | 5 |
| Fuel Type | Petrol (Gasoline) |
| Power | 120 Hp @ 5500 rpm |
| Power per litre | 100.1 Hp/l |
| Torque | 170 Nm @ 1750-4000 rpm |
| Torque (lb.-ft.) | 125.39 lb.-ft. @ 1750-4000 rpm |
| Engine layout | Front, Transverse |
| Engine Model/Code | Revotron |
| Engine displacement | 1199 cm3 |
| Engine displacement (cu. in.) | 73.17 cu. in. |
| Number of cylinders | 3 |
| Engine configuration | Inline |
| Number of valves per cylinder | 4 |
| Fuel injection system | Multi-port manifold injection |
| Engine aspiration | Turbocharger, Intercooler |
| Engine oil capacity | 3.5 l |
| Engine oil capacity (US qt) | 3.7 US qt |
| Engine oil capacity (UK qt) | 3.08 UK qt |
| Coolant | 5.5 l |
| Coolant (US qt) | 5.81 US qt |
| Coolant (UK qt) | 4.84 UK qt |
| Engine systems | Start & Stop System |
| Trunk (boot) space – minimum | 382 l |
| Trunk (boot) space – minimum (cu. ft.) | 13.49 cu. ft. |
| Fuel tank capacity | 44 l |
| Fuel tank capacity (US gal) | 11.62 US gal |
| Fuel tank capacity (UK gal) | 9.68 UK gal |
| Length | 3995 mm |
| Length (in.) | 157.28 in. |
| Width | 1804 mm |
| Width (in.) | 71.02 in. |
| Height | 1620 mm |
| Height (in.) | 63.78 in. |
| Wheelbase | 2498 mm |
| Wheelbase (in.) | 98.35 in. |
| Ride height (ground clearance) | 208 mm |
| Ride height (ground clearance) (in.) | 8.19 in. |
| Drivetrain Architecture | The Internal combustion engine (ICE) drives the front wheels of the vehicle. |
| Drive wheel | Front wheel drive |
| Number of gears and type of gearbox | 6 gears, manual transmission |
| Front suspension | Coil spring, Independent type McPherson |
| Rear suspension | Semi-independent, coil spring, Transverse stabilizer |
| Front brakes | Disc |
| Rear brakes | Drum |
| Assisting systems | ABS (Anti-lock braking system) |
| Steering type | Steering rack and pinion |
| Power steering | Electric Steering |
| Tires size | 195/60 R16; 215/60 R16 |
| Wheel rims size | 16 |
